COMBAT HOSPITAL – 10:00PM (ABC) ABC’s ambitious new summer drama follows a group of military doctors tending to wounded soldiers in Afghanistan. And yes, you certainly think of the names “M*A*S*H” and “China Beach” any time a show promises medical care, gallows humor, and armed conflict all in one tidy package. There’s still a great show to be made out of our current batch of wars. FX’s “Over There” never managed to stick. And “Generation Kill” on HBO was just a miniseries. At some point, there will be a War on Terror show that Americans don’t steadfastly avoid like the plague. Maybe this is the one. ANTICIPATION: BLOODY!
